Output 16dc94ba2ce8d7fafa05617a6eac0a15c7d4a8cab39c032d9ca37e0f1236685e:58

value
15445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e2ba20d7631a83f89e9b0c4fdf1137ad1fdc12 OP_EQUAL
address
3PCGKtww17w73duGK1x4inQj81wodcop5X
transaction
16dc94ba2ce8d7fafa05617a6eac0a15c7d4a8cab39c032d9ca37e0f1236685e
spent
true